Beefy Media is a game production consulting and business development support company founded in 2010.

At this point, you've almost certainly encountered Adam Boyes on or around Giant Bomb. When he's not paying the Giant Bomb community to design his Christmas cards, he's popping up in various videos or podcasts from time to time to lend his special brand of expertise. It's led to a few questions, like "what the hell does that guy do?" Today, we have at least a partial answer.
Adam's company, Beefy Media, has teamed up with The Weinstein Company to turn the production company's film and television properties into games. Specifically, Beefy will "oversee all production aspects of the games."
But which properties are actually being turned into games? That part's apparently still a secret. The studio is currently working on Spy Kids 4, Scream 4, a Fraggle Rock movie, and upcoming pictures with great names like Submarine, Dirty Girl, and Butter. So maybe some of those will end up in some kind of interactive format at some point? I would totally play a submarine game called Submarine. Heck, I would play any game called Butter.
We'll start drunk dialing Adam in the middle of the night until we get some hard answers out of him.
